Member Groups

We often get asked what the stars under names in posts stand for. Well, here's a small explanation.

There are two types of groups - post based and assigned. The first set, post based, means that the more you post, the better the title (Ratz Newbie to Ratz God) that you get in your profile. It also means that you get more stars (or different coloured ones!). This occurs automatically the more you post (but if we catch anyone posting nonsense just to increase post count, there will be trouble!). The assigned member groups are different. You can only be a part of them if an admin gives you the permission. There are different types of assigned groups. Team Members mean the advice you give is very reliable and we know that you can count on the advice given by one of these members. Moderators are those that moderate the boards and this title is ONLY given out once we are satisfied someone is trustworthy, honest and a frequent visitor. Admin Aides and Admins are the ones that run the boards. You cannot ask to join an assigned membergroup, but if we believe you have earned the right, we may ask you if you would like the position.

As for the stars, this is how they are worked out:

Normal groups (you go up the more you post):
Ratz Newbie - 0 to 49 posts - one normal star
Ratz Jr Member - 50 to 99 posts - two normal stars
Ratz Full Member - 100 to 199 posts - three normal stars
Ratz Sr Member - 200 to 299 posts - four normal stars
Ratz Hero Member - 300 - 499 posts - five normal stars
Ratz Legend Trainee - 500 to 749 posts - 1 green star
Ratz Legend Junior - 750 to 999 posts - 2 green stars
Ratz Legend Senior - 1000 to 1499 posts - 3 green stars
Ratz Trainee God - 1500 to 1999 posts - 4 green stars
Ratz God - 2000+ posts - 5 green stars

Assigned groups (can only be in these if you are given the position by an admin):
Advice Team Member - 4 yellow stars
Advice Team Leader - 5 yellow stars
Moderator - 5 blue stars
Admin Aid - 4 red stars and 1 blue
Admin - 5 red stars
On A Warning - you get a shield
